Oracle快照恢复最简单方法 远程恢复靠谱吗
2025-07-31 04:31:02 来源:技王数据恢复

引言段
在现代企业中,数据的安全性和可恢复性至关重要。随着信息技术的快速发展,越来越多的企业依赖于Oracle数据库来存储关键数据。数据丢失或损坏的情况时有发生,这给企业带来了巨大的损失。如何快速有效地恢复数据成为了每个数据库管理员必须面对的挑战。在这种情况下,Oracle快照恢复技术应运而生,它提供了一种简便的方式来恢复数据。远程恢复的可靠性也是一个不容忽视的问题。本文将深入探讨Oracle快照恢复的简易方法及远程恢复的可靠性分析,帮助您更好地应对数据恢复的挑战。
常见故障分析
在使用Oracle数据库的过程中,用户常常会遇到几类典型故障,这些故障可能导致数据丢失或无法访问。以下是几种常见的故障类型:
1. 硬件故障
硬件故障是导致数据丢失的主要原因之一。例如,某公司在进行系统升级时,服务器硬盘突然损坏,导致数据库无法启动,数据处于不可访问状态。如果没有及时的快照备份,数据恢复将变得非常困难。
2. 操作失误
操作失误同样是造成数据丢失的常见原因。比如,某用户在进行数据清理时,不小心删除了重要的表数据,导致业务无法正常运行。在这种情况下,如何通过Oracle快照恢复来快速找回丢失的数据显得尤为重要。
3. 软件故障
软件故障也可能导致数据库崩溃或数据损坏。例如,某次Oracle数据库升级后,出现了严重的兼容性问题,导致数据无法正常读取。对于这种情况,快速的快照恢复能够帮助企业尽快恢复正常业务。
操作方法与步骤
工具准备
在进行Oracle快照恢复之前,需要确保以下工具和资源的准备:
- Oracle数据库管理工具,例如SQLPlus或Oracle Enterprise Manager。
- 备份的快照文件,确保快照是在故障发生之前创建的。
- 足够的存储空间用于恢复过程。
环境配置
在恢复之前,需对数据库环境进行配置:
- 确保Oracle数据库服务处于停止状态,以避免数据冲突。
- 检查数据库的当前状态,确保没有未完成的事务。
- 配置好网络环境,确保能够访问到备份快照文件的存储位置。
操作流程
接下来,按照以下步骤进行Oracle快照恢复:
-
启动恢复工具:打开SQLPlus或Oracle Enterprise Manager,连接到目标数据库。
-
执行恢复命令:使用以下命令恢复快照:
RECOVER DATABASE USING BACKUP CONTROLFILE;
此命令将使用备份控制文件进行恢复。
-
应用快照:应用快照文件,确保数据恢复到故障发生前的状态。
ALTER DATABASE OPEN;
-
验证数据完整性:恢复完成后,检查数据库中的数据是否完整,确保没有遗漏。
注意事项
在进行Oracle快照恢复时,需要注意以下几点:
- 确保在恢复之前进行全面的备份,以防止数据丢失。
- 在恢复过程中,不要进行其他操作,以免造成数据冲突。
- 定期测试恢复过程,确保在实际故障发生时能够快速恢复。
实战恢复案例
案例一:硬件故障恢复
某企业在进行硬件更换时,发生了硬盘损坏,导致数据库无法启动。通过使用Oracle快照恢复技术,该企业在2小时内成功恢复了50GB的数据,恢复率达到了95%。
案例二:操作失误恢复
某用户在清理无效数据时,误删了重要表。通过Oracle快照恢复,该用户在30分钟内恢复了20GB的数据,恢复率为100%。
案例三:软件故障恢复
某公司在升级Oracle数据库后,出现了严重的兼容性问题,导致数据无法访问。通过快照恢复技术,该公司在1小时内恢复了所有数据,恢复率为98%。
常见问题 FAQ 模块
以下是一些用户常见的问题及解答:
Q: 格式化后还能恢复吗?A: 如果有快照备份,格式化后的数据是可以恢复的。
Q: NAS误删数据有救吗?A: 只要有快照或备份,NAS误删的数据可以恢复。
Q: 快照恢复需要多长时间?A: 恢复时间取决于数据量和系统性能,通常在几分钟到几小时之间。
Q: 远程恢复的安全性如何?A: 远程恢复在数据传输过程中需要加密,确保数据安全。
Q: 如何选择恢复工具?A: 选择操作简便且功能强大的恢复工具,例如Oracle自带的恢复工具。
Q: 恢复后如何验证数据完整性?A: 可以通过对比备份与恢复后的数据进行验证。
立即行动,保护您的数据安全
如您遇到类似问题,欢迎联系我们技王!立即拨打 免费咨询,获取专业的技术支持。我们在全国范围内设有9大直营网点,包括北京、上海、杭州、武汉、成都、沈阳、长春、深圳和重庆,随时为您提供服务,确保您的数据安全无忧!